CVE-2020-35698 describes a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Thinkific Online Course Creation Platform 1.0, affecting the underlying CMS used by numerous online course providers. An unauthenticated attacker can exploit this by crafting a malicious URL, leading to arbitrary code execution in the victim's browser. Rated as Medium severity (CVSS 6.1), the attack requires user interaction (UI:R) by clicking a specially crafted link, but has low attack complexity (AC:L) and no authentication required (PR:N). Successful exploitation could result in client-side information disclosure and manipulation. There is no evidence of active exploitation, nor are there publicly available exploit modules in Metasploit, Nuclei, or ExploitDB. Community discussion and media coverage for this CVE are minimal.
